How to Use Smart & Easy Plumbing App

1. Set Your Start Node
Determine the center of your pipe’s start face (X₁, Y₁). Often you can set X₁=0 and Y₁=0 if it’s your reference. For Z₁, measure how high that face is above the ground (e.g., if it’s 10 inches above ground, set Z₁ = 10). Then choose the face direction (e.g., +X, +Y, +Z) and the connection type (Male or Female).

2. Set Your End Node
Measure the end face center (X₂, Y₂) relative to the start face. For Z₂, use the same ground reference if it’s level, or the vertical offset if the ground is uneven. Select the face direction and the connection type (Male or Female).

3. Choose Pipe Size, Elbows, and Alignment
Pick your pipe size, then select whether you want only 90° elbows or both 90° and 45° elbows. You can optionally force the path to remain at the same Z-level if your design requires a flat or specific vertical alignment. This can sometimes yield a simpler or shorter path.

4. Add Obstacles (Optional)
If there are obstacles (walls, equipment, or other pipes), specify them by entering two corner points of the obstacle’s bounding box:

  • Lower corner (X₁, Y₁, Z₁): Often Z₁=0 at ground level.

  • Upper corner (X₂, Y₂, Z₂): Usually includes the obstacle’s height.

Provide a clearance (CLR) value that’s at least as large as the pipe diameter, ensuring the path stays a safe distance away.

5. Compute Path
Tap “Compute Path” to calculate the route. The app displays:

  • Segment lengths and total pipe length

  • Number of elbows/fittings

  • Approximate cost (if available)

Use these details to cut, label, and assemble your pipe segments.

6. Convert Path to Obstacle
Once the path is computed, you can convert the current (plumbed) path into obstacles by tapping the “Convert Path” button. This feature locks in the installed pipe as an obstacle using a clearance based on a fraction of the pipe diameter (typically pipe diameter/4). This ensures that any new pipe route will be computed so that it avoids colliding with the already installed pipe. Use this feature if you plan to run a second pipe along or near the same route.

7. Clear
Tap “Clear” to reset your inputs and start a new calculation.
